So I had my FMT yesterday at the Mayo Clinic in Arizona. They had somebody cancel so they got to move me up. I wouldn't have gotten in until November otherwise. I really lucked out. I'm so excited to start the healing process. For the most part, I think it went really well, but only time will tell.

The prep for was pretty awful. They had me do half in the evening and half in the morning. The moviprep they had me use tasted terrible and they specifically said not to flavor it at all. It was tough, but all I could think about was how excited I was to finally be getting the FMT. I was still going when I got to the Mayo Clinic Hospital and took the Imodium. I literally took the Imodium after leaving the bathroom.

They took me back and prepped me to go in for the procedure. The FMT coordinator came in and went over the procedure with me again and a little of what to expect afterwards. Apparently, they got a really good, big sample from the donor. She seemed pretty excited about it. More bacteria for me, I guess. She did say that because the sample was so big, they decided to take a little more than usual and that I might experience more discomfort afterward because of it. Or as she put it, what goes in must go out.

They took me back, performed the FMT, and I woke up in recovery. I had crazy bad gas pains and lost a little of the sample trying to pass some gas to relieve the pain, but it was a tiny amount. I went home and didn't go again until this morning around 8 or 9 am. It was a small amount again and formed.

Overall, I've been feeling pretty good so far. I've been more energized today, more positive and less anxious. When I had active c diff, I would have a racing heart when I would go to sleep which would sometimes trigger a panic attack and that disappeared. After dinner tonight, I had a massive amount of D though. I think that it was either the Moviprep still making it's way out now that the Imodium has worn off (since I was still going from the evening dose of prep before I started the morning dose and I was still going in the morning when I got in), or I ate something my body didn't like. Yesterday, I was so excited and felt so good I know that I ate some risky foods. I stayed within the parameters they gave me at Mayo (low residue the first day and then I could add anything I wanted back in slowly), but I probably went overboard. I'll definitely be taking it slower from now on. Because of the lingering effects of the Imodium though, I feel like I'll never really know what caused that. I highly doubt it's c diff back. It seems rather early for it to be making a comeback, only three days after stopping Vanco and one day after getting treated by FMT. Also, it wasn't at all like the D I had with active c diff. Also, if anyone is considering doing an FMT at Mayo in Phoenix, Arizona, they were very sure to tell me that they no longer allow patients to use donors of their choice. They only allow you to use donors from their standard donor list that they have already screened and continue to screen three to four times a year. It sounded like they made this change for two reasons. One, the testing was expensive and a lot of people's insurance didn't cover it, and two, it sounded like they were having problems with a lot of people's donors failing the testing. I don't know if that has been posted anywhere else on the site, but this is their new policy. So if anyone is adamant about using their own donor, they might want to look at going somewhere else. I don't know if this is the case for all branches of the Mayo Clinic, but it is for the one in Phoenix.

I have had more than one FMT. They put in liquefied stool, so what goes in, has to come out. It didn't go in solid, so it won't come out solid. I did get food intolerances after, more from all the vanco I was on I think than the FMT, but I got them nonetheless, so add foods back carefully and don't overdo.

Some c did experts stress adding high fiber foods after the FMT - whole grains, fresh veggies and fruits, beans. Add gradually. They are supposed to feed the new good bacteria.
